Please join GIPA for a special virtual presentation to hear about hot topics in intellectual property from various regions around the world, presented by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office’s IP Attaché Program.

Dominic Keating, the Program Director for the IP Attaché Program in the Office of Policy and International Affairs—along with attachés based in UAE, Brazil, Europe, China, India, and the U.S. Eastern Regional office of the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office—will share information on pressing issues relevant to IP owners and practitioners alike. Following their presentations, there will be a Q&A time for participants.
